Output 674019f8f176fc9cc4bd455ecd44e51c34a0a8dd2b2a28dfb6fcee89ff029662:2

value
136092
script pubkey
OP_0 OP_PUSHBYTES_20 c50e6dda9f5015b3659b5af9582abf5839d55128
address
bc1qc58xmk5l2q2mxevmttu4s24ltqua25fguqnhzn
transaction
674019f8f176fc9cc4bd455ecd44e51c34a0a8dd2b2a28dfb6fcee89ff029662
spent
true